WITH KURDISH PEOPLE: NEWROZ 2005

(Written by the Italian delegation in Sirnak, Turkish Kurdistan, for the 2005 Newroz celebration)

The Kurds represent the most numerous people on the planet without a land of their own. The majority of them live in eastern Turkey. Since 1920 they have asked fort the right to exist, and for their language, history and culture to be respected.They still have not obtained this. They have sought dialogue with the state, they have used guns in order to defend themselves, they have proposed a negotiated solution; but Turkey has never listened to them. Turkey has always used violence and acted unmercifully against them. All of us, who know and love the Kurdish people, hoped that with the negotiation for entrance into the EU, Turkey would bring into harmony and put into practice the laws in respect of the minorities. This has not happened. We fear, along with all our Kurdish friends, that in fact nothing has changed, and that the dream to see the Kurd issue resolved remains such. .
